I know you can disable automatic application update emails (such as Wordpress) on a global basis but can you disable them on an individual domain?
 
Hi
If you log into your server via SSH you can run the following commands. This will show whether the mail service is activated on the domain:

/usr/local/psa/bin/domain -i domain.example.com | grep “Mail service”

This will turn off the mail service for the subdomain (Using true instead of false will turn it back on):

/usr/local/psa/bin/domain -u domain.example.com -mail_service false
